C Diagnostics Collection Script

Running diagnostics collection script provide additional information so My Oracle Support can resolve problems.

Syntax

diagcollection.pl {--collect [--crs | --acfs | -all] [--chmos [--incidenttime time [--incidentduration time]]] [--adr ___location [--aftertime time [--beforetime time]]] [--crshome path | --clean | --coreanalyze}]

Note:

Prefix diagcollection.pl script arguments with two dashes (--).

Parameters

Table C-1 diagcollection.pl Script Parameters

Parameter Description
--collect

Use this parameter with any of the following arguments:

  • --crs: Use this argument to collect Oracle Clusterware diagnostic information

  • --acfs: Use this argument to collect Oracle ACFS diagnostic information

    Note: You can only use this argument on UNIX systems.

  • --all: (default) Use this argument to collect all diagnostic information except Cluster Health Monitor (OS) data.

  • --chmos: Use this argument to collect the following Cluster Health Monitor diagnostic information

    --incidenttime time: Use this argument to collect Cluster Health Monitor (OS) data from the specified time

    Note: The time format is MM/DD/YYYYHH24:MM:SS.

    --incidentduration time: Use this argument with --incidenttime to collect Cluster Health Monitor (OS) data for the duration after the specified time

    Note: The time format is HH:MM. If you do not use --incidentduration, then all Cluster Health Monitor (OS) data after the time you specify in --incidenttime is collected.

  • --adr ___location: The Automatic Diagnostic Repository Command Interpreter (ADRCI) uses this argument to specify a ___location in which to collect diagnostic information for ADR

  • --aftertime time: Use this argument with the --adr argument to collect archives after the specified time

    Note: The time format is YYYYMMDDHHMISS24.

  • --beforetime time: Use this argument with the --adr argument to collect archives before the specified time

    Note: The time format is YYYYMMDDHHMISS24.

  • --crshome path: Use this argument to override the ___location of the Oracle Clusterware home

    Note: The diagcollection.pl script typically derives the ___location of the Oracle Clusterware home from the system configuration (either the olr.loc file or the Microsoft Windows registry), so this argument is not required.

--clean

Use this parameter to clean up the diagnostic information gathered by the diagcollection.pl script.

Note: You cannot use this parameter with --collect.

--coreanalyze

Use this parameter to extract information from core files and store it in a text file.

Note: You can only use this parameter on UNIX systems.
